At Qonto, our AML/CFT system (Anti-Money Laundering/Combating the Financing of Terrorism) is divided into two levels:
The Ops - AML/CFT team, referring to the Operations department, performs operational controls to ensure our client base is not exposed to Money-laundering or Terrorist Financing risks (level 1)
The Financial Security team, referring to the Compliance department, is in charge of the definition and supervision of the AML/CFT system and performs enhanced investigations in case of suspicion (level 2)

👩💻🧑💻 As a Financial Security Analyst / TRACFIN correspondent, you will
• Learn about Money Laundering, Terrorism Financing, Corruption, and Fraud from a team of experts
• Investigate screening escalations from level 1 (politically exposed persons, sanction lists, high-risk customers)
• Perform enhanced investigations in case of suspicious activities of clients and issue Suspicious Transaction Reports (STR) when necessary.
• Be part of projects to enhance our capacities to detect suspicious behaviors.
